With reference to the accompanying drawings, the present design includes a bottom edge having straight front and side edges, and a rearwardly convex rear edge. A surface extends upward from the bottom edge, then becomes outwardly convex and extends upward and inward to a lower edge. Above this lower edge lies a front base portion and a rear base portion.The front base portion maintains a generally square cross-section and has an outwardly convex surface which extends upward and inward, and then extends upward to intersect with an outwardly concave surface which extends upward and inward, and then becoming planer and intersecting with the bottom surface of a reservoir portion.The rear base portion intersects with the rear of the front base portion and has side surfaces which extend upward and slightly inward, and from the front is outwardly concave and extends rearward and outward, then becoming outwardly convex, intersects with the rear surface of the rear base portion. The rear surface of the rear base portion has a rearwardly convex surface which extends upward and forward, and then becomes planer and intersects with the bottom surface of the reservoir portion. A rearwardly concave surface is disposed in the central portion of the rear surface of the rear base portion.The reservoir portion includes a planer horizontal top surface defined by inner and outer edges, each having a forwardly convex forward edge and straight side and rearward edges. An upwardly convex surface extends along the rearward edge and rear third of the side edges. From the inner edge a surface extends downward from the rearward edge, and an upwardly concave surface extends downward and inward from the forward and side edges, to a circular recess. From the forward and side edges of the outer edge an outwardly concave surface extends downward and outward, then becomes outwardly convex and extends downward and outward, then downward and inward, becoming outwardly convex again and extending downward and inward to an edge. From this edge a downwardly convex surface extends downward and inward to intersect with the base portions. From the rear edge of the outer edge a surface extends downward to intersect with a rearwardly convex surface which extends downward and inward. A central portion of the rear reservoir surface is recessed forward and inward.Drawings of the design are included wherein:Figure 1 is a right, top, front perspective view of a bidet embodying the new design;Figure 2 is a top plan view thereof,Figure 3 is a right side elevational view thereof, the left side elevational view being a mirror image of the right side shown;Figure 4 is a front elevational view thereof,Figure 5 is a rear elevational view thereof; andFigure 6 is a bottom plan view thereof.
